Required documents

  • Old DNI

    The old or valid DNI to be renewed. Original, not a copy.

  • Size passport photo

    Recent, in color, white background, no glasses, no accessories on the head. Size: 32×26 mm.

  • Payment receipt of tasa 790-012

    Completed and stamped form by bank or electronic payment receipt.

  • ?

    Residency certificate Optional

    Only required if there is a change in domicile from the old DNI.

    ⚠️ Only if change of domicile

Step by step

  • 1

    Schedule appointment online

    Go to official site

    Access the National Police Sede Electrónica and request an appointment for DNI/Pasaporte renewal in Elche. Choose 'DNI Issue' and select the nearest office.

  • 2

    Pay the tasa 790-012

    Go to official site

    Download, fill out and pay the form model 790-012 (€12). You can pay online with a card through the Sede Electrónica or print the form and pay at any bank.

  • 3

    Attend office on day of appointment

    Present yourself at Elche Police Station with all documents: old DNI, photo, paid receipt and (if applicable) residency certificate.

  • 4

    Receive new DNI (on same day)

    The new DNI is delivered on the spot after completing the appointment. No need to return another day. Use the 'DNIe Update Points' available at the station to activate PIN and electronic certificates.

Frequently asked questions

Can I renew my DNI without an appointment?
No. Since 2020, appointments are mandatory in all Spanish offices.
How much does it cost to renew the DNI in 2026?
The current fee is €12 (tasa 790-012). The first issue for minors under 14 years is free, and there's no charge for renewal due to loss or theft reported.
What happens if my DNI has been expired for years?
There's no penalty for having an expired DNI in civil matters. The procedure and cost are the same. However, it is not valid for international travel.
How long does it take to receive the new DNI?
The DNI 4.0 is delivered on-site at the end of the appointment, within 15-20 minutes. You don't have to return another day. If there's a technical issue, they will inform you and schedule another appointment.
Can a minor renew their DNI?
Yes, but must be accompanied by a parent, guardian or legal tutor who must present their own DNI.
How do I request an appointment to renew my DNI?
Visit citapreviadnie.es, select 'DNI/Pasaporte Issue', choose province and police station, and pick a date and time. If there are no appointments available, try connecting at 08:00 AM when new slots become available.
Is the DNI delivered on site?
Yes. The new DNI 4.0 is issued during the same appointment, usually in 15-20 minutes. You don't have to return another day for pickup.
When does the DNI expire?
Validity depends on age at renewal: under 5 years → 2 years; 5 to 29 years → 5 years; 30 to 69 years → 10 years; 70 years or more → permanent (indefinite).
Can I renew my DNI before it expires?
Yes. You can apply when there's less than 1 year left until expiration, although many stations process it even earlier. There is no penalty for renewing in advance.
What should I do if I lose or have my DNI stolen?
You must file a loss or theft report (in any police station or through the National Police Sede Electrónica). With the report number, request an appointment on citapreviadnie.es. In this case, tasa 790-012 is waived.
